Black Diamond Group  (OTCPK:BDIMF) 9-Day RSI Explanation

The Relative Strength Index (RSI), developed by J. Welles Wilder in his book “New Concepts in Technical Trading Systems.”, is a momentum oscillator that measures the speed and change of price movements. The RSI is most typically used on a 14-day period, measured on a scale from 0 to 100.

Traditionally, an asset is considered overbought or overvalued when the RSI is above 70 and oversold or undervalued when it is below 30. A RSI surpasses the 30 level indicates a bullish sign, when it slides below 70 level, it’s a bearish sign. This level can be adjusted depending on the security’s pattern and the market’s underlying trend. In an uptrend or bullish market, the RSI might range within a higher interval, investors could set the support level higher. If a downtrend or bearish market occurs, investors may need to lower the resistance level.

RSI can also be used in trading techniques to indicate the trading signal, such as Divergences and Swing Rejections. A shorter period RSI is more reactive to recent price changes, so it can show early signs of reversals. 9-Day RSI is sometimes used together with 14-Day RSI in a two period divergence strategy.

Black Diamond Group Business Description

Other Exchanges 8B8:GermanyBDI:Canada
Address 440-2nd Avenue SW, Suite 1000, Calgary, AB, CAN, T2P 5E9
Black Diamond Group Ltd is a specialty rentals and industrial services company with two operating business units - Modular Space Solutions and Workforce Solutions, which operate in Canada, the United States and Australia. Modular Space Solutions provides modular space rentals to customers throughout North America. Workforce Solutions provides workforce housing solutions including rental of accommodations and surface equipment, provision of full turnkey lodge services and provision of travel management logistics through the company's online digital marketplace, LodgeLink.
